It’s a trip back to one of the most surreal moments in hockey history!

Guest host Dave Campbell steps in for a special segment of Inside Sports and welcomes NHL insider John Shannon to the show. Together, they revisit the 5th anniversary of the NHL's unprecedented COVID playoff bubble in Toronto and Edmonton — a time when hockey pressed on in empty arenas, under strict protocols, and with the Stanley Cup on the line.

What worked? What didn’t? How did the league pull off such a massive undertaking? And what lasting impact did the bubble have on the NHL, the players, and the two Canadian host cities?
